WARNING NOTES:
Lack of concern for proper bracing during r•.onatruction cpn result In
serious accidents. Under normal conditions if the following guidelines are
observed, accidents will be avoided.
1. All blocking, hangers and lira
joists at the end supports of
the joists must be completely
installed and properly nailed.
2. Lateral strength, like a braced
end wall or an existing deck,
rnust be established at the
ends of Ole bay T his can also
be accomplished by a teihlporai
or permanent deck (shedIlung)
nailed to the first 4 feet of joists
at the end of the bay

3. Temporary strut lines of 1 x 4
(rain.) must be nailed to a
braced end wall or sheathed
area as in note 2 and to each
joist. Without this bracing,
buckling sideways or roll over
is highly probably under light
construction loads -like a
y worker and one layer of
unnailed sheathing.
4. Sheathing must be totally
attached to each joist before
additional loads can be placed
on the system.
5. Ends of cantilevers require
strut lines on both the top and
bottom flanges
6. The flanges must remain
straight within a tolerance of
1/2` front the true alignment.
